Huntington Beach, Calif. - It looked like the Golden West offense finally found their rhythm early in the match as they dominated ball possession against MiraCosta College Monday night but it stalled out in a 1-1 tie.
The Rustlers (1-2-2) got on the board in the 12th minute when Wilbert LoredoSuarez delivered a sweet touch pass to a streaking Jonathan Ruiz for a early 1-0 lead. About 10 minutes later the Golden West defense had a breakdown in communication as the goalkeeper Misha Marson called for the ball in the 18yd box but his defender try to head the ball out. The header led to a MiraCosta (1-1-2) goal as Cole Simes was able to loft the ball over Marson for a one hopper into the net to tie the match at 1-1 in the 18th minute.
Both teams traded opportunities over the next 70 minutes with a couple good looks at the goals but ultimately they would end in the 1-1 tie.
